    Very good song. The sound of both the AKAI and the Yamaha are very attractive. Of course, the whole setup is less minimalistic than that you showed on your video #63 (great one really). I would like to know if I am interpreting the wiring correctly: 1) the AKAI is connected to the input of the Yamaha; 2) the Yamaha is connected to the input of the Rode AI-1; and 3) the output of the AI-1 goes to your monitor. Well, my question (not a great question, I know) would be: what is recording all these stuff? A set of microphones or just one, which brand and so on. This is just because the output is really nice. Thank you very much!

    • @coffebeats
      @coffebeats  9 หลายเดือนก่อน +4

      Hey, yes, you are partially right in therms of my setup in those episode. Rode AI-micro is connected via Lightning cable to my iPhone. There is also headphones out from Rode that I have connected headphones to. So I hear signal that is coming back from loopy and my devices. The magic of stereo recording is done by Loopy Pro. You can record whole session without metronome recorded, with effects loops on / off, live. I could use for this iPhone screen recording also, but then it would contain metronome click also. Hope this helps
